[发明专利]高动态弱信号下基于DCFT的块补零码捕获方法有效
申请号: | 201510288388.4 | 申请日: | 2015-05-29 |
公开(公告)号: | CN104931982B | 公开(公告)日: | 2017-03-22 |
发明(设计)人: | 张华;许录平;吴超;孙景荣;赵闻博;程鹏飞 | 申请(专利权)人: | 西安电子科技大学 |
主分类号: | G01S19/30 | 分类号: | G01S19/30 |
代理公司: | 北京科亿知识产权代理事务所(普通合伙)11350 | 代理人: | 汤东凤 |
地址: | 710071 陕西省*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 动态 信号 基于 dcft 块补零码 捕获 方法 | ||
技术领域
本发明涉及导航信号捕获技术领域,具体涉及高动态GPS信号的捕获参数预测方法。
背景技术
全球定位系统(Global Pos i tioning System,GPS)信号是经过直接序列扩频调制的扩频信号。在室内、密集城区等弱信号环境中,遮挡、多径和干扰等现象较为严重,GPS信号功率由于受到各种穿透损耗会严重衰减,所以需要长时间积累得到高的检测峰值,才能提高信号的检测概率。但是在高动态下弱信号捕获会面临两个问题:第一,高动态下多普勒频移会对积累峰值产生影响;第二,比特符号翻转会对积累峰值产生影响。
为了能在高动态下捕获L1弱信号,Chun提出了BASIC(Block Accunulating Semi-coherent Integration of Correlation)方法,计算后相关信号的共轭块信号,即差分后相关信号,然后将所得信号进行快速傅里叶变换(FFT),进而对高动态参数(初始频率,调频斜率,比特符号)进行估计,此方法是一个开环捕获,非常适合软件接收。但是此方法没有考虑高动态下对本地码相位的补偿,且此方法利用后相关得到的共轭信号较原信号信噪比降低,不利用进一步提高积累峰值。
发明内容
针对现有技术的不足,为了在高动态下更好地捕获GPS弱信号,本发明旨在提供一种基于离散调频傅里叶变换(discrete chirp Fourier transform,DCFT)块补零(Block Zero-padding Approach based on DCFT,BZA_DCFT)捕获方法,从而在较BASIC更低的信噪比下捕获信号,得到信号的高动态参数。
为了实现上述目的,本发明采用如下技术方案:
高动态弱信号下基于DCFT的块补零码捕获方法,包含如下步骤:
步骤1,对接收到的后相关信号按不同比特翻转位置b进行分块处理,分块后每个数据块表示为其中,k=1,...,K,K表示要求的数据比特有K比特;所述后相关信号表示如下:
其中,A为信号幅度,n为采样点数,bn=±1为比特符号,f0为初始频率,α为调频斜率,φ0为初始相位,wn为后相关信号的噪声,Ts为采样间隔,sn为后相关有用信号;
步骤2,记不同初始频率和调制斜率的求和矩阵为不同初始频率和调制斜率的数据比特矩阵为其中m和l表示矩阵和的行数和列数;令k=0,并初始化为全零矩阵,为空矩阵,按照k=1,...,K进行循环迭代,计算得到数据块的求和矩阵和数据比特矩阵,单次迭代的过程具体如下:
2.1)对数据块按照其在后相关信号的位置进行补零,得到补零后的数据块hk;
2.2)对补零后的数据块hk进行离散调频傅里叶变换DCFT:
2.3)求出第k位比特数据:
2.4)更新求和矩阵数据比特矩阵
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201510288388.4/2.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G01S 无线电定向;无线电导航;采用无线电波测距或测速;采用无线电波的反射或再辐射的定位或存在检测;采用其他波的类似装置
G01S19-00 卫星无线电信标定位系统;利用这种系统传输的信号确定位置、速度或姿态
G01S19-01 .传输时间戳信息的卫星无线电信标定位系统,例如,GPS [全球定位系统]、GLONASS[全球导航卫星系统]或GALILEO
G01S19-38 .利用卫星无线电信标定位系统传输的信号来确定导航方案
G01S19-39 ..传输带有时间戳信息的卫星无线电信标定位系统,例如GPS [全球定位系统], GLONASS [全球导航卫星系统]或GALILEO
G01S19-40 ...校正位置、速度或姿态
G01S19-42 ...确定位置